The plaintiff Van Dorn Retail Management, Inc. ("Van Dorn Retail") brought this action for recovery on a personal guaranty against the defendant Louis Georgopoulos. Georgopoulos was the president of the defendant Jim's Oxford Shop, Inc. ("Jim's" or "Retailer"). The court has jurisdiction over this matter pursuant to 28 U.S.C.A. § 1332(a) (West 1993).
